Giới thiệu
Trong thời đại công nghệ 4.0, trí tuệ nhân tạo (AI) đang ngày càng phát triển mạnh mẽ. Để tối ưu hóa hiệu quả của các mô hình ngôn ngữ lớn (LLMs), việc làm chủ các kỹ thuật kỹ thuật prompt nâng cao trở nên thiết yếu. Chất lượng phản hồi của một LLM phụ thuộc rất nhiều vào cách mà các câu hỏi được cấu trúc và trình bày. Những điều chỉnh nhỏ trong cách đặt câu hỏi có thể làm thay đổi đáng kể chất lượng đầu ra. Hướng dẫn toàn diện này sẽ khám phá những phương pháp tinh vi như phân tách tự hỏi, suy luận theo chuỗi và nhắc nhở từng bước - những công cụ giúp LLM giải quyết các vấn đề phức tạp thông qua phân tích hệ thống và giải quyết từng bước.
Kỹ Thuật Một Lần và Một Vài Lần
Kỹ thuật một vài lần (few-shot prompting) là một phương pháp mạnh mẽ, nơi người dùng cung cấp các ví dụ cụ thể trong prompt để hướng dẫn mô hình ngôn ngữ đến các đầu ra mong muốn. Kỹ thuật này giúp thiết lập các mẫu và kỳ vọng rõ ràng cho phản hồi của mô hình.
Hiểu Biết Cơ Bản
Cách tiếp cận này bao gồm việc thêm các cặp đầu vào-đầu ra đại diện để minh họa chính xác cách mà bạn muốn mô hình phản hồi. Những ví dụ này phục vụ như các mẫu, giúp AI hiểu các định dạng, phong cách hoặc mẫu suy luận cụ thể mà bạn đang tìm kiếm. Khi chỉ sử dụng một ví dụ, nó được gọi là kỹ thuật một lần (one-shot prompting), trong khi việc không sử dụng ví dụ nào được gọi là kỹ thuật không lần (zero-shot prompting).
Ví Dụ Triển Khai
Giả sử bạn muốn dạy một mô hình ngôn ngữ chuyển đổi tiếng Anh hiện đại sang ngôn ngữ thời Victoria. Một prompt được cấu trúc tốt có thể bao gồm nhiều ví dụ thể hiện sự chuyển đổi mong muốn:
- Tiếng hiện đại: "Bạn cảm thấy thế nào hôm nay?"
- Tiếng Victoria: "Ngươi đang làm gì vào ngày tốt đẹp này?"
- Tiếng hiện đại: "Tôi cần đi ngay bây giờ."
- Tiếng Victoria: "Tôi phải rời đi ngay lập tức."
Các Thực Hành Tốt Nhất
Kỹ thuật này chứng minh là có giá trị nhất khi:
- Nhiệm vụ yêu cầu định dạng cụ thể mà có thể không rõ ràng ngay lập tức.
- Bạn cần mô hình áp dụng một phong cách hoặc tông viết cụ thể.
- Đầu ra mong muốn tuân theo một mẫu hoặc cấu trúc độc đáo.
- Bạn muốn đảm bảo tính nhất quán giữa nhiều phản hồi.
Ứng Dụng Chiến Lược
Kỹ thuật một vài lần tỏ ra xuất sắc trong các tình huống mà các prompt tiêu chuẩn có thể không đáp ứng đủ. Nó đặc biệt hiệu quả cho các nhiệm vụ chuyên biệt như chuyển đổi định dạng, so khớp phong cách, hoặc các mẫu suy luận phức tạp. Những ví dụ này hoạt động như các hướng dẫn rõ ràng, giảm thiểu sự mơ hồ và nâng cao độ chính xác của phản hồi của mô hình. Bằng cách chọn lựa ví dụ đại diện một cách cẩn thận, người dùng có thể hướng mô hình sản xuất các đầu ra gần giống với yêu cầu của họ.
Phân Tách Tự Hỏi
Phân tách tự hỏi (self-ask decomposition) là một phương pháp tiên tiến, nơi những câu hỏi phức tạp được chia nhỏ thành các thành phần nhỏ hơn, dễ quản lý. Phương pháp này cho phép các mô hình ngôn ngữ giải quyết các vấn đề tinh vi bằng cách xử lý từng yếu tố một cách có hệ thống trước khi tổng hợp thành một giải pháp hoàn chỉnh.
Cơ Chế Cốt Lõi
Kỹ thuật này hoạt động bằng cách hướng dẫn mô hình xác định và liệt kê các câu hỏi phụ thiết yếu giúp trả lời câu hỏi chính. Thay vì cố gắng giải quyết một vấn đề phức tạp trong một bước, mô hình tạo ra một khung phân tích có cấu trúc bằng cách chia nhỏ thách thức thành các thành phần riêng biệt.
Ứng Dụng Thực Tế
Xem xét một câu hỏi quyết định nghề nghiệp phức tạp như "Tôi có nên chuyển sang nghề trí tuệ nhân tạo không?" Sử dụng phân tách tự hỏi, mô hình sẽ chia nhỏ câu hỏi này thành các thành phần phụ quan trọng:
- Bạn có nền tảng chuyên môn hiện tại nào?
- Những vai trò cụ thể trong AI nào thu hút bạn?
- Các khoảng trống kỹ năng giữa vị trí hiện tại và yêu cầu của AI là gì?
- Những nguồn lực (thời gian, tiền bạc, giáo dục) nào có sẵn cho việc chuyển đổi?
- Thị trường việc làm AI tại khu vực của bạn như thế nào?
Lợi Ích và Triển Khai
Cách tiếp cận này mang lại nhiều lợi ích:
- Đảm bảo phân tích toàn diện các vấn đề phức tạp.
- Ngăn ngừa việc bỏ sót các yếu tố quan trọng trong quá trình ra quyết định.
- Tạo ra một tiến trình suy nghĩ hợp lý.
- Sản xuất các phản hồi sâu sắc và có lý hơn.
Khi Nào Sử Dụng
Phân tách tự hỏi tỏ ra có giá trị nhất trong các tình huống liên quan đến:
- Quy trình ra quyết định đa diện.
- Giải quyết vấn đề phức tạp yêu cầu nhiều bước.
- Tình huống mà việc bỏ qua chi tiết có thể dẫn đến phân tích không đầy đủ.
- Các câu hỏi yêu cầu xem xét nhiều biến số hoặc quan điểm.
Bằng cách triển khai phân tách tự hỏi, người dùng có thể hướng dẫn các mô hình ngôn ngữ sản xuất các phản hồi sâu sắc, có cấu trúc tốt mà giải quyết tất cả các khía cạnh liên quan của các câu hỏi phức tạp. Cách tiếp cận có hệ thống này đảm bảo rằng không có yếu tố quan trọng nào bị bỏ qua trong quá trình phân tích.
Suy Luận Theo Chuỗi (CoT)
Suy luận theo chuỗi (Chain-of-Thought - CoT) cách mạng hóa cách mà các mô hình ngôn ngữ tiếp cận các vấn đề phức tạp bằng cách khuyến khích suy nghĩ theo từng bước hợp lý. Kỹ thuật này bắt chước các mẫu giải quyết vấn đề của con người, dẫn đến kết quả chính xác và minh bạch hơn.
Nguyên Tắc Cơ Bản
CoT hướng dẫn các mô hình AI phân tích quá trình suy luận của chúng thành các bước rõ ràng, thay vì nhảy ngay vào kết luận. Bằng cách thể hiện rõ ràng tiến trình hợp lý, người dùng có thể hiểu rõ hơn cách mà mô hình đến được câu trả lời của nó và xác định các lỗi tiềm ẩn trong lý luận.
Chiến Lược Triển Khai
Kỹ thuật này thường bao gồm việc thêm các cụm từ cụ thể để kích hoạt suy nghĩ tuần tự. Ví dụ:
- "Hãy giải quyết điều này một cách có hệ thống..."
- "Hãy hướng dẫn tôi qua lý luận của bạn..."
- "Chia nhỏ điều này từng bước một..."
Ứng Dụng Thực Tế
CoT tỏ ra xuất sắc trong nhiều tình huống:
- Các phép toán toán học yêu cầu nhiều bước.
- Suy luận logic phức tạp.
- Phân tích vấn đề lập trình.
- Quy trình ra quyết định nhiều giai đoạn.
Giải Quyết Vấn Đề Nâng Cao
Xem xét một bài toán từ ngữ toán học: "Nếu một cửa hàng giảm giá 20% cho một sản phẩm có giá 150 đô la, sau đó thêm 8% thuế, giá cuối cùng là bao nhiêu?" Một cách tiếp cận CoT sẽ cho thấy:
- Tính toán mức giảm giá: 20% của 150 đô la = 30 đô la
- Trừ đi mức giảm giá: 150 đô la - 30 đô la = 120 đô la
- Tính thuế: 8% của 120 đô la = 9.60 đô la
- Cộng thuế để có giá cuối: 120 đô la + 9.60 đô la = 129.60 đô la
Tích Hợp Với Các Kỹ Thuật Khác
CoT có thể được nâng cao bằng cách kết hợp với các phương pháp khác:
- Ví dụ một vài lần thể hiện mẫu suy luận mong muốn.
- Kiểm tra tính tự nhất quán ở mỗi bước.
- Xác minh các kết quả trung gian.
Các mô hình AI hiện đại thường tự nhiên sử dụng suy luận theo chuỗi, nhưng việc nhắc nhở CoT rõ ràng có thể cải thiện hiệu suất của chúng, đặc biệt là trong các nhiệm vụ phức tạp yêu cầu phân tích chi tiết hoặc nhiều bước tính toán. Cách tiếp cận này không chỉ dẫn đến kết quả chính xác hơn mà còn cung cấp cái nhìn giá trị vào quá trình lý luận của mô hình.
Kết Luận
Việc làm chủ các kỹ thuật kỹ thuật prompt sẽ biến đổi cách chúng ta tương tác với và sử dụng các mô hình ngôn ngữ lớn. Những phương pháp tinh vi này - từ kỹ thuật một vài lần đến suy luận theo chuỗi - cung cấp những công cụ mạnh mẽ để khai thác các phản hồi chính xác, tinh tế và đáng tin cậy từ các hệ thống AI.
Mỗi kỹ thuật phục vụ các mục đích cụ thể: kỹ thuật một vài lần thiết lập các mẫu rõ ràng thông qua các ví dụ, phân tách tự hỏi chia nhỏ các vấn đề phức tạp thành các thành phần dễ quản lý, và suy luận theo chuỗi tiết lộ các bước hợp lý phía sau các giải pháp. Bằng cách chọn lựa phương pháp phù hợp cho từng tình huống, người dùng có thể nâng cao đáng kể chất lượng của các phản hồi do AI tạo ra.
Hiệu quả của những phương pháp này cho thấy rằng nghệ thuật kỹ thuật prompt không chỉ đơn thuần là các tương tác hỏi-đáp. Nó đòi hỏi sự hiểu biết về cả khả năng và giới hạn của các mô hình ngôn ngữ, trong khi có chiến lược cấu trúc các đầu vào để tối đa hóa tiềm năng của chúng. Khi công nghệ AI tiếp tục phát triển, những kỹ thuật nhắc nhở này sẽ có khả năng phát triển và mở rộng, cung cấp những cách thức tinh vi hơn để tương tác với trí tuệ nhân tạo.
Đối với những người làm việc với hệ thống AI, việc đầu tư thời gian vào việc học và áp dụng các phương pháp kỹ thuật prompt này có thể dẫn đến kết quả cải thiện đáng kể. Cho dù giải quyết các vấn đề phức tạp, tạo nội dung sáng tạo hay tìm kiếm phân tích chi tiết, kỹ thuật nhắc nhở phù hợp có thể tạo ra sự khác biệt giữa một phản hồi cơ bản và một giải pháp toàn diện, có lý luận tốt.